Output 88760d91c0ddf1053fb6c9be89c5d9c39f6682eb089ff27ad207a2b6e424526a:1

value
2095303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c1fdab84352f9b8f6b318683b0c51100e5caa9 OP_EQUAL
address
3EtRcteRaXDsg5jWe2e5oCRKFFL9ityFVC
transaction
88760d91c0ddf1053fb6c9be89c5d9c39f6682eb089ff27ad207a2b6e424526a
spent
true